Birding center at SPI grand opening Saturday

SOUTH PADRE ISLAND, Texas (AP) - Bird watchers from around the globe have another reason to head to South Texas.

The $6.5 million South Padre Island Birding and Nature Center will hold a grand opening on Saturday as part of the World Birding Center.

The attractions include a boardwalk, seven bird blinds and a five-story tower with views of the Laguna Madre and the Gulf of Mexico.

Manager Cate Ball says the center includes fresh water, brackish water and salt water habitats. Ball says the wetlands attract numerous kinds of wading and shore birds.

The center is south of the South Padre Island Convention Center.
